Transaction e124a4ae749fcb5546e097e415693eaa1d938bb3de6ae7faf74f002093822913
1 Input
1 Output
-
e124a4ae749fcb5546e097e415693eaa1d938bb3de6ae7faf74f002093822913:0
- value
- 2137713
- script pubkey
- OP_0 OP_PUSHBYTES_20 ce2aa81629c7053e2ed4fcb440e12c2963a8f8fa
- address
- bc1qec42s93fcuznutk5lj6ypcfv993637863a3g3w